Authorities in Fond du Lac have provided an update on the man who died after getting trapped under an inflatable dock at a swimming pond at the Breezy Hill Campground on Thursday evening.
According to the Fond du Lac County Sheriff’s Office, the man who died has been identified as 39-year-old Fond du Lac resident Paul Becker.

It’s the last week of summer camp for Philadelphia Parks and Rec, but the city is hoping the benefits of this six-week camp season will last for years.
For the first time, Philadelphia Parks and Rec summer camps provided universal swim lessons for all campers enrolled in summer camps at sites that had open pools.
“As of the last count, about 3,000 kids did swim lessons this summer,” said Bill Salvatore, the deputy commissioner of programming at Philadelphia Parks and Rec.
Ponte Vedra native and four-time Olympic gold medalist swimmer Ryan Murphy announced Thursday that he, alongside his parents and grandfather, have signed on as franchisees to open a swim school for kids in St. Johns County, according to a news release.
Construction for the ‘Goldfish Swim School’ is currently underway at 2420 County Road West in St. Johns, Florida and is expected to open in the spring of 2024. The location will mark as the first in Northeast Florida and will create approximately 50 jobs, the release states.
